2011 Towards Clean Energy Production - Managing CO2 For Enhanced Oil Recovery And Carbon Capture And Storage
8:30 AM - 5:00 PM
Description
PTAC Petroleum Technology Alliance Canada invites you to attend the PTAC Towards Clean Energy Production – Managing CO2 for Enhanced Oil Recovery and Carbon Capture and Storage event. This innovative event will focus on technology development, applications, demonstrations, regulations and legalities to address a wide array of industry needs for CO2 CCS and EOR.
This event will focus on carbon capture, transportation, hydrocarbon recovery, and sequestration, and will provide valuable case study presentations that highlight how technology has achieved promised environmental and economic gains. The presentations will be followed by interactive question and answer sessions with the presenters, and will finish with an afternoon networking reception to exchange ideas and discuss challenges and new technology solutions with colleagues and presenters.
This event will appeal to both engineers as well as corporate decision makers, and policy makers that endeavor to find solutions that bolster economic gains through research, technology and innovation.
Presentation speakers and topics
- Keynote – Dr. David Keith – ISEEE, University of Calgary
- Carbon Capture and Storage Development in Alberta – Chris Arnot, CCS Regulatory Framework Assessment Team
- Continuing to Integrate EOR and CCS – A Saskatchewan Update – Ken Brown, Petroleum Technology Research Centre
- Alberta’s CCS Answer – John Zhou, Alberta Innovates – Energy & Environment Solutions
- The IPAC-CO2 Incident Response Protocol: Development and Implementation – Dr. George Sherk – IPAC-CO2
- Shell Quest Project – Ian Silk, Shell Canada Energy
- Enzymatic CO2 Capture – Jonathan Carley, CO2 Solution
- Carbon Management: A Global EPCM Perspective – Brian Maksymetz, WorleyParsons
- CO2 EOR in Western Canada – Bruce Peachey, New Paradigm Engineering
- Update on Legal and Regulatory Issues – Alan Harvie, Macleod Dixon LLP
